Mural at the World Cultures Festival, 2025

✅ Location and Scale

  • The mural was created at the intersection of Szczerkowskiego and Teligi streets in Grodzisk Mazowiecki.

  • It is unique because it spans two adjacent buildings, covering a total of about 260 m² (approximately 130 m² on each wall).

  • ✅ Theme and Inspiration

  • The main theme: a Slavic couple dancing or basking in the sun – a symbolic return to roots and Central European culture.

  • Previous editions featured murals inspired by Africa and Taiwan, while this year focused on the Slavic region, highlighting the festival’s cultural diversity.

✅ Authors and Creators

  • Design and execution: art collective WypiszWymaluj ( ), known for creating murals for earlier editions of the festival.

  • This is the third consecutive mural by the same team for the event.

✅ Creative Process

  • Around 300 spray paint cans were used to complete the artwork.

  • The project was coordinated with the Grodzisk Mazowiecki City Hall, and the painting process lasted several days, allowing residents to watch it live.

✅ Official Unveiling

  • The mural was officially unveiled on July 25, 2025, at 12:00 PM, marking the symbolic opening of the festival.
